Fiber optic sensors for seismic wave detection

This paper proposes a fiber optic multi-parameter seismic observation system based on fiber optic interferometric sensors for seismic wave detection. The multi-parameter fiber optic seismic probe, including a 3-componet fiber optic seismometer a 4-componet strainmeter and a fiber optic temperature sensor, is developed using the fiber optic Michelson interferometers. The interrogator, using phase generating carrier technology, has a high resolution of 10-5 rad/Hz1/2. The probe is installed in a 60m deep borehole for long-term observation. The observation results show that all sensors can detect the seismic wave signals of the earthquakes, even teleseismic earthquakes from the coast of Taiwan. Moreover, the fiber optic strain sensors also can measure the earth tide. The fiber optic multi-parameter seismic observation system is expected to provide rich data for seismic wave detection in seismology and geophysics.
